The Mermaids were hosted at the National Yacht Club for Volvo Dun Laoghaire Regatta and got the full schedule of nine races completed from Thursday to Sunday (July 10-13) in the Salthill race area. The class makes a special mention of its Salthill, Dublin Bay race officer, David Wilkins, and team, who ran an 'exceptionally professional operation', which made for a very enjoyable few days on the water.
Race Officer David Wilkins on the VDLR Salthill course Photo: Michael Chester
The event was won overall by ‘102 Endeavour’ from Rush Sailing Club helmed by Darach Dineen with crew Max Dineen/Alan O’Rourke, and Breda Magner. Second place went to ‘134 Jill’ from the Royal Irish Yacht Club, helmed by Paul Smith with crew Pat Mangan and Ailbhe Smith. Third place went to ‘119 Three Chevrons’ from Foynes Yacht Club helmed by Vincent McCormack with crew Roisin McCormack and Michael Lynch.

The timing of the event offered the Mermaids a great chance for four days of racing practice in the run up to the Dublin Bay Mermaid National Championships being held at Wexford Harbour Boat & Tennis club from the 30th July - 2nd August.
